详细阐明了低温锂电池智能充放电电路设计,并通过实验研究验证低温锂电池的容量和充放电特性.研究结果表明:基于BQ2057充电管理芯片和MIC29302稳压芯片设计的充放电电路实现了对锂电池的科学充放电,实际应用中充电、供电稳定可靠.

The design of intelligent charging and discharging circuit for cryogenic lithium batteries was described. The capacity and charging and discharging characteristics of cryogenic lithium batteries were verified by experimental research.
